Why Did Mike Tyson Slap Jake Paul?
At first, we were delighted to see The Problem Child getting slapped around the chops in boxing news. After the dust had settled, we then began to ask: Why? Why did Tyson slap Paul so aggressively, when the pair are literally going to punch each other inside the AT&T Stadium?
After reviewing the tape, the internet analysts spotted Paul stepping on Tyson’s right foot. He was notably shoeless, wearing nothing but his socks as his opponent’s crisp white kicks stepped on his toes. Therefore, his reaction before the pair even managed to face off for longer than a second makes more sense.
Here’s a fun fact you likely didn’t know, and more boxing rumors that explain Tyson’s crazy man behavior: During an interview back in 2019, Iron Mike explained how he hates feet:
“And I have the worst feet in the world. And if somebody steps on my feet, I would totally tap out. I would just give up; it would be a no-brainer.”

Paul’s Response to the Slap
Paul didn’t back down following the altercation. In fact, he seemed furious, and rightfully so.
“I didn’t even feel it. He’s angry. He’s an angry little elf. Mike Tyson, I thought that was a cute slap, buddy, but tomorrow, you’re getting knocked the f*ck out. I’m f*cking him up. He hits like a b*tch. It’s personal now. He must die,” Paul screamed on the microphone immediately after he was slapped.
